KARACHI: MMA strives for supremacy of constitution against LFO



By Our Staff Reporter


KARACHI, June 2: Sindh President of Muttahida Majlis-i-Amal, Asadullah Bhutto, has said that the MMA considers Legal Framework Order (LFO) against the nation and the country while opposition parties were striving for the supremacy of constitution and the parliament.

Speaking at a seminar on the “Legal Framework Order”, MNA Asadullah Bhutto traced the history of challenges to the parliament and the constitution from the inception of Pakistan.

The JI Karachi chief, Dr Mairaj-ul-Huda Siddiqui, addressing party workers at Idara Noor-i-Haq said that MMA stand on the LFO was not only principled, but also in accordance with the constitution and the law as an individual was not authorised to amend the constitution.

Referring to the NWFP, he said that the MMA government there was a manifestation of the sentiments of people and their aspirations.
